Ac-DEVD-pNA
Ac-DEVD-pNA, a chromophore featuring para-nitroaniline, serves as a peptide linker cleaved by caspases. In the process of apoptosis, caspase-3 becomes activated and selectively cleaves various substrates, such as po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ase, specifically recognizing the DEVD amino acid sequence.
